About Doug Binns
Doug Binns is a scholar working on Nature and Landscape Conservation, Global and Planetary Change, Ecology, Ecology, Evolution, Behavior and Systematics and Plant Science, having authored 17 papers that have together received 594 indexed citations. Recurring topics across this work include Ecology and Vegetation Dynamics Studies (11 papers), Fire effects on ecosystems (9 papers), Rangeland and Wildlife Management (6 papers), Plant Parasitism and Resistance (3 papers), Plant and animal studies (3 papers), Hydrology and Sediment Transport Processes (2 papers), Plant Water Relations and Carbon Dynamics (2 papers) and Forest ecology and management (2 papers). The work is most often cited by research in Nature and Landscape Conservation (328 citations), Global and Planetary Change (308 citations), Ecological Modeling (60 citations), Ecology (313 citations) and Soil Science (69 citations). Doug Binns has collaborated with scholars based in Australia and China. Frequent co-authors include Trent D. Penman, Andrew J. Beattie, Emma Pharo, Rodney P. Kavanagh, D. R. Melick, Amy Jansen, Ian D. Lunt, Christine Stone, P. E. Bacon and Sally A. Kenny. Their work appears in journals such as Austral Ecology, Forest Ecology and Management, Conservation Biology, Journal of Hydrology and Australian Journal of Botany.
